Pullout compensation bill stalled at Israeli Knesset committee
www.chinaview.cn 2004-12-29 05:58:11

   JERUSALEM, Dec. 28 (Xinhuanet) -- The Constitution, Legislation andLaw Committee of the Israeli Knesset (parliament) on Tuesday tiedin a vote on the Evacuation Compensation Bill, which lines outfinancial compensation for settlers who are to be evacuated underthe disengagement plan, the Jerusalem Post reported.   The bill can not be put for vote in the Knesset before it isapproved by the committee, while Israeli Prime Minister ArielSharon hopes to bring the bill to final readings in the Knesset byearly 2005, the report said.

   The committee will vote for the second time on the bill in thecoming weeks after additional financial matters regardingevacuation are concluded, added the report.

   The government is making a budget of 2.2 billion sheckels (500million US dollars) for the disengagement plan, under which Israelwill withdraw from all the 21 settlements in the Gaza Strip andfour in the West Bank by 2005.

   However, expenses are expected to rise to as high as 5 billionsheckels (1.136 billion dollars), including costs for the IsraelDefense Forces' redeployment.

   Each family is to receive an average compensation of 300,000dollars under the bill.  Enditem
